Effect of Sleep on Metabolic process
When it concerns fat burning, comprehending the effect of sleep on metabolism is vital. Rest plays a significant role in regulating your body's metabolic process, which is the procedure of converting food right into energy. Throughout sleep, your body deals with repairing tissues, synthesizing hormonal agents, and regulating various physical functions. Lack of rest can disrupt these procedures, causing inequalities in metabolic rate.
Research study has revealed that insufficient sleep can influence your metabolic process by altering hormone levels associated with appetite and appetite. Specifically, inadequate sleep can lead to a rise in ghrelin, a hormonal agent that stimulates appetite, and a reduction in leptin, a hormone that reduces appetite. This hormonal inequality can lead to overindulging and desires for high-calorie foods, which can undermine your weight-loss goals.

Role of Sleep in Hormone Law
As you delve much deeper into the connection between rest and weight reduction, it becomes apparent that the function of sleep in hormonal agent policy is a key factor to think about. Rest plays a crucial duty in the guideline of different hormones that affect hunger and metabolic rate. One essential hormonal agent impacted by rest is leptin, which aids regulate energy equilibrium by inhibiting hunger. Absence of sleep can cause lower degrees of leptin, making you really feel hungrier and possibly resulting in overeating.
Additionally, rest starvation can interfere with the manufacturing of ghrelin, an additional hormone that promotes cravings. When ghrelin levels are elevated because of inadequate rest, you might experience more powerful yearnings for high-calorie foods.

Impact of Sleep on Food Cravings
Rest plays a considerable duty in influencing your food cravings. When you do not get sufficient rest, your body experiences disturbances in the hormones that control appetite and volume. This discrepancy can bring about a rise in ghrelin, the hormonal agent that stimulates hunger, while decreasing leptin, the hormonal agent that signifies volume. Consequently, you might find yourself craving high-calorie and sugary foods to offer a quick power increase.
Additionally, absence of sleep can affect the mind's incentive facilities, making junk foods extra attractive and more challenging to stand up to.
Research has actually revealed that sleep-deprived individuals often tend to pick foods that are greater in fat and calories contrasted to when they're well-rested. This can undermine your weight management initiatives and lead to undesirable weight gain in time.
